Pena::Metode SetAlignment (gdipluspen.h)

Metode Pena::SetAlignment mengatur perataan untuk objek Pena ini relatif terhadap garis.

Sintaks

Status SetAlignment(
  [in] PenAlignment penAlignment
);

Parameter

[in] penAlignment

Jenis: Penalignment

Elemen enumerasi Penalignment yang menentukan pengaturan perataan pena relatif terhadap garis yang digambar. Nilai defaultnya adalah PenAlignmentCenter.

Nilai kembali

Jenis: Status

Jika metode berhasil, metode mengembalikan Ok, yang merupakan elemen dari enumerasi Status .

Jika metode gagal, metode mengembalikan salah satu elemen lain dari enumerasi Status .

Keterangan

Jika Anda mengatur perataan objek Pena ke PenAlignmentInset, Anda tidak dapat menggunakan pena tersebut untuk menggambar garis mampul atau tutup tanda hubung segitiga.

Contoh

Contoh berikut membuat dua objek Pena dan mengatur perataan untuk salah satu pena. Kode kemudian menggambar dua baris menggunakan masing-masing pena.

VOID Example_SetAlignment(HDC hdc)
{
   Graphics graphics(hdc);

   // Create a black and a green pen.
   Pen blackPen(Color(255, 0, 0, 0), 1);
   Pen greenPen(Color(255, 0, 255, 0), 15);

   // Set the alignment of the green pen.
   greenPen.SetAlignment(PenAlignmentInset);

   // Draw two lines using each pen.
   graphics.DrawEllipse(&greenPen, 0, 0, 100, 200);
   graphics.DrawEllipse(&blackPen, 0, 0, 100, 200);
}

Persyaratan

Persyaratan Nilai
Klien minimum yang didukung Windows XP, Windows 2000 Professional [hanya aplikasi desktop]
Server minimum yang didukung Windows 2000 Server [hanya aplikasi desktop]
Target Platform Windows
Header gdipluspen.h (termasuk Gdiplus.h)
Pustaka Gdiplus.lib
DLL Gdiplus.dll

Lihat juga

Pena

Pena::GetAlignment

Penalignment

Pena, Garis, dan Persegi Panjang

Mengatur Lebar dan Perataan Pena